Samuel Arthur Boatman Jr was born in 1917 in McAlester, Pittsburg County, Oklahoma, USA, the child of Samuel Arthur "Artie" Boatman and Cecil Beatrice ( Bea) Turner. In 1920, Samuel Arthur Boatman Jr resided in Schulter, Okmulgee, Oklahoma, USA. In 1930, Samuel Arthur Boatman Jr resided in Haskell, Muskogee, Oklahoma, USA. Samuel Arthur Boatman Jr married Nellie Virginia Miller, and had children including Frances Carolyn Boatman, Mary Beatrice Boatman. Samuel Arthur Boatman Jr passed away in 1954 in Kansas City, Wyandotte County, Kansas, USA.
